pH(0)/E(0)

Electrode zero point of the sensor.

Next calibration

Date on which the next calibration is to be carried out. If calibration data
monitoring is switched on and if the set date is before the current date (i.e.
the calibration has not yet been carried out) then the date will be shown in
red.

Additional columns from the Sensor properties can be shown with the menu
item Edit

Column display.

Note

Lines that contain red entries will also show the line number with a red
background.

Table view
The sensor table cannot be edited directly. With a click on the column title
the table can be sorted according to the selected column in either increasing
or decreasing sequence. The table view can be adapted with the left-hand
mouse button as follows:

Drag the margin between column titles:
Sets the column width

Double-click on the margin between column titles:
Sets the optimal column width

Drag the column title:
Moves the column to the required location

If the contents of a field is larger than the column width then the whole
contents will be shown as a tooltip if the mouse cursor is kept on the field.

Functions
The menu Edit beneath the sensor table contains the following menu items:

New…

Adds new sensor manually (see Chapter 6.7.2.3, page 1311).

Delete

Deletes the selected sensor (see Chapter 6.7.2.4, page 1312).

Properties…

Edits the selected sensor (see Chapter 6.7.3.1, page 1313).

Column display…

Defines columns for the sensor table(see Chapter 6.7.2.2, page 1311)

Print (PDF)…

Outputs the sensor table as a PDF file(see Chapter 6.7.2.5, page 1312)
